1. Riga Christmas Market<\/h3>\n\n\n
\n
\"Streets<\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n

The main Riga Christmas market is located on Doma Laukums, the main square, while the other is not far away on Livu Laukums.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Another smaller Christmas market on Esplanade Park in front of the Orthodox Cathedral.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

On Saturdays, there is a Christmas Fair in the Kalnciems Quarter<\/a> on the other side of the Daugava River.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Here you will find goods from Latvian farmers, artisans, designers, and music and Latvian or Baltic region plants.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

This market actually takes place year-round but has a Christmas feel in December.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Kalnciems Quarter is a district worth visiting for the market, Latvian cultural events, and unique timber architecture.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

2. Daugavpils<\/strong> Christmas Market<\/h3>\n\n\n\n

The Daugavpils Christmas Market is located on Rigas Street, where you’ll find many beautiful lights and decorations around the streets and parks.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Daugavpils is Latvia’s second-largest city, located in south-eastern Lativa close to both the Lithuanian and Belarusian borders.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

It’s very off the beaten path for most foreign tourists, but it’s an interesting place to visit. It’s especially worthwhile if you’re heading to Lithuania after your time in Latvia.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Historically, Daugavpils has been part of Poland and later the Russian Empire. It retains cultural influences from these periods, making it one of Latvia’s more interesting destinations.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Today Daugavpils is predominantly ethnic Russian. The city is filled with beautiful East Orthodox religious buildings, Art Nouveau architecture and celebrated red brick buildings.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

4. Jelgava<\/strong> Ice Sculpture Festival<\/h3>\n\n\n\n

Conveniently close to Riga, Jelgava is easy to get to if you have time to visit more than just the capital. It’s notable for its palaces, parks, historic churches and wild horses.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Jelgava is a city located about 41 kilometres southwest of Riga, Latvia’s capital city. Every winter, Jelgava hosts an annual Ice Sculpture Festival, one of Latvia’s most popular winter events.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

During the festival, talented ice sculptors from around the world create stunning works of art from blocks of ice displayed throughout the city.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

In addition to the ice sculptures, the festival also features a range of activities and events, such as live music, ice skating, and winter sports.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

In addition to the festival, Jelgava is home to several other attractions, including the historic Jelgava Palace and beautiful parks, making it a worthwhile destination to explore during the holiday season.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Christmas in Latvia<\/h2>\n\n\n\n

Christmas in Latvia is a special time, typically celebrated as a family affair. While the festivities revolve around traditional dishes and a Christmas feast, the focus is less on Christmas Day and more on the Winter Solstice.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

Many people in Latvia decorate their homes with natural decorations, such as pine cones, branches, and other festive greenery, in addition to having a decorated natural tree.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Food plays an important role in Latvian Christmas celebrations, with families often preparing a variety of traditional dishes. However, modern and international twists are increasingly being incorporated into the Christmas feast.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

It’s common for families to spend the day cooking and preparing for the feast, which is typically enjoyed together in the evening.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

The Christmas market is a must-see attraction for those visiting Latvia during the holiday season. Latvians are encouraged to buy presents for their loved ones at the market, which features handmade ornaments, toys, homewares, and unique artisan gifts.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

As a visitor, you can also take part in this tradition and find the perfect gift for someone special.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

In Latvia, presents are usually opened on Christmas Eve, which is a time for families to come together and celebrate. <\/p>\n\n\n\n
